Ever wonder how an island gets its name? The tale of Ziegenwerder begins with goats. This real natural island sits between the Alte and Neue Oder in Frankfurt. It owes its name to the goats of Oder fishermen. They once grazed and fed here.

In the 19th and 20th centuries, Frankfurt residents flocked to Ziegenwerder. Swimming baths lined the river. These offered leisure and recreation. The last remnants of these baths disappeared in 2003. This happened when the Europagarten was created.

Today, Ziegenwerder is an island of contrasts. The eastern part remains largely untouched. It features huge old trees. This lower-lying area often floods in spring and autumn. The western part has transformed into a park. Here, you can find a promenade. There are also extensive flowerbeds.

Narrow watercourses symbolize the Oder. These are modeled on the river itself. A hedge theater offers catering. A panorama cinema entertains visitors. A large adventure playground delights children. Seasonal events add to the island’s appeal. Movies and concerts draw crowds.

Ziegenwerder is not just a park. It is also a bird sanctuary. Its unspoiled areas provide habitat. Over 100 species of animals and plants call it home. As you stroll around Ziegenwerder, you might spot deer. You could see rare birds. A beaver might even make an appearance.

The island has a rich history. It served as a leisure spot in the 18th and 19th centuries. People came here for the bathing. In 2003, it was redesigned as the Europagarten. The side facing the Oder remains wild. It is largely untouched by development. Towards the city, Ziegenwerder is a varied park. A beer garden welcomes guests. A fireplace provides warmth. Enchanting weeping willows grace the waterways.

Ziegenwerder offers something for everyone. Nature lovers can explore its wild side. Families can enjoy the playground. Culture enthusiasts can attend events. Everyone can appreciate the island’s beauty.

From Ziegenwerder, an inviting promenade stretches. It runs to the Winterhafen. This offers a lovely view of the Oder. The island has two access points. One is near the streetcar loop. The other bridge leads to the university campus. This provides a route back to the city center.
